Transaction 30d2814a39d69a497bc8a7b86cd6586a03ee318c3e8c98ac7ef7019a11b47959
1 Input
2 Outputs
- 30d2814a39d69a497bc8a7b86cd6586a03ee318c3e8c98ac7ef7019a11b47959:0
- 30d2814a39d69a497bc8a7b86cd6586a03ee318c3e8c98ac7ef7019a11b47959:1
value 33621110
address 1Lryr2vcnsw4fDWbfe1eXAUYW5wrLHXMeA
value 32389
address 16z2njRX431kiDF99TdzwojWsQnFWZGYUu